The Setup

“They’re alive! By the sky above, I know, I saw them! They’re still there - it’s just like I told you! They’re trapped! We have to send help!”

The words of a crazy man, ringing through the center of town as he swings like a wild baboon from the bannisters on the Central Gazebo. People laughed, they threw tomatoes. They told him he was insane, but of course he’d heard it a thousand times. Soon people grew bored, and they wandered off, leaving the man to scream into the dark night with nobody to listen to him. They were there. He had seen it - he remembered now. He spoke it aloud, over and over, but nobody came to listen or to pretend to be interested. His voice was lost by morning, and he wandered home with no idea where home was.

It was so long ago, longer than they could remember, that they had real heroes. Not superheroes, not heroes who went on epic quests, but heroes who were more than merely people. They were beloved and the world swarmed to them with wants and desires. And they never batted a lash - they were kind and patient enough for the entire world. Everyone rejoiced at the sight of them . . . and all shed tears when they disappeared. There were a million theories as to what had happened, but all that is known is that they left the city and went onto land to see what was beyond. They never returned. That was thirty years ago.

Years later, a man named Zeno Herceg went onto land and came out with glazed-over eyes and a mindless stupor from which he never recovered - never except for those moments when he seemed to suddenly remember something, and he’d go screaming through the streets about the six heroes and where they’d gone. People started to call him crazy, and soon nobody listened to a word he had to say.

Until two weeks ago.

Zeno died quietly in his sleep, and without a single heir to inherit anything of his, the government seized his property - and found the map. Nobody has seen the map, but they say it’s the map the six heroes themselves followed, the route across the land and to - to whatever lies across it. With a great outcry from the people, the government swore to follow this map and track down their heroes. So a group was sent out, with more supplies than they could ever need and a great cheering crown backing them - but you weren’t one of them. You may have wished them well, or been riddled with jealousy, or simply not cared. And after a few days, you probably moved on with your life. Until you received the letter.

It may have started with a simple request: please agree to aid on a quest to find the six heroes and come meet me alone at The Desperado to discuss details. If you refused this request, it might have been followed up with threats, bribery, or blackmail. No matter who you showed or whether you kept it to yourself, the authorities brushed it off with alarming indifference and the letters were untraceable. And so you had no choice - you came. Alone, or with backup, whatever it was, you’re here now and it’s time to find out who wants you and why - and meet the others.

The Setting

The city has floated across the sea aimlessly for as far back as anyone can remember. The wooden frame rots from the inside, and many say a day will come when the whole city of Victory will sink into the ocean, and all of its people with it. Of course, many believe this is poppycock. Sink? Victory? As if it could. The city is huge and mostly wooden, with the slums on the lower half, and the fancy establishments hauling in more fish than any ship ever could. Pirates and sailors tie their ships to the docks and go drinking, telling tales of the land that have grown so tall nobody knows any longer which are true. People save seeds like precious gems and fight over good soil and crops, so scarce here. But one thing always remains the same: every person, big or small, has heard of land, though few have ever been there. Once in a blue moon, every ten or so years, there will be an earth-splitting shake and everyone will rush to their homes, trying to figure out which side it came from. Those who are bold - and lucky - can jump from Victory to the land it’s bumped up against, but government officials are quick to cast off again, and many people miss and are drowned, trampled, or severely injured. Riots and fights with government officials are common, and the most deaths of one day in Victory history have always been on Landing Days. Those who leave don’t come back, and the best you can hope to see if you don’t jump is a few rocks, mountains, hilly tussocks.

This is a medieval city made almost entirely of wood - and thus highly discouraging fire - and based entirely upon the sea. The fishing industry is booming, farming is difficult and laborious, and all water must be boiled before being drunk. The names here are almost all after items or ideas. Higher-class citizens might name their child after a virtue they want them to embody. Lower-class kids are often named after simple items. Some hopefuls might name their kids after nature in hopes of them seeing land, and some might give them elegant names to carry them through life. Surnames apply only to higher-class people, and may be any kind. The government is known to be very strict about land and the distribution of resources, and very lax about crime. That, in fact, is why the heroes were so widely honored: they were the law in some ways, the ones who kept things running smoothly and who punished lawbreakers. Accounts of six such figures are known throughout history, and some people believe they're the same people coming back again and again in different forms, unaware of their connection with their previous selves. Though the idea of organized religion is uncommon in the city, many places and people leave offerings to their favorite hero, wishing for them to return home safely.

I encourage each of you to add to the culture and worldbuilding of Victory. More information on careers, religion, the government, cultures, and the heroes is always welcome. Just either PM me or put it on the discussion page.

The Heroes


Sage

Sage, the leader of the heroes by many accounts, was a leader by every definition of the word. She was very much in control of her team, and they in return had great faith in her. She was also vain and very young. People say she came from the land, though nobody can prove it, and she was known to reject the idea of magic outside of Victory. She’s one of the most popular heroes, and a great many books, comics, and ballads have been written about her.


Valor

Though the firecest, Valor was far from the muscle of the team. He was quick-thinking, clever, and always thought of unusual solutions. He was the unattainable lover, never interested in anyone, and is considered by some to be shallow because of people’s romantic interest in him. He is, however, also known as the embodiment of the balance between might and mind.


Demure

At first glance, Demure was a snappy, tough-love kind of gal, the opposite of her name. But her renown is for her kindness towards everyone, those more or less fortunate, though who were cruel or too kind for their own good. Her sarcasm didn’t undermine her genuine compassion for everyone around her. She was convinced of magic outside of Victory, and was badly scarred. She was known for loving her hometown of Try, which is where she’s mostly honored.


Haven

She was the only one to follow one of the old religions, despite them being out of fashion. She was devoted, quiet, and stoic, and many went to her for advice or help with domestic issues. Everything she had she gave away, though her shy nature was well-known as well. She’s the second most honored besides Sage.


Bluejay

This person was of no particular gender, the one considered least helpful because of their fun-loving and emotional nature. They are often dismissed, but those who do honor them realize the importance of the laughter they brought. They never had fun at the expense of others, and in places that were hit the hardest they could always make people feel happy again, if just for a little while. They’re the least commonly honored.


Fable

Fable was the one who brought order to the group, and fairness to the law. He was known for hating the idea of law without empathy, and who viewed each case differently, considering them as a unique case each time. This made him the most controversial. His rough history with his own crime in youth has also lost him followers, but he’s considered the greatest example of a redemptive arc.

The Characters

For your character, I ask that you choose a type of character and a trait to embody. You may mix and match any and may request that new ones be made (which I will discuss with you), but nobody may have the same archetype or trait. For the traits, these only reflect why your character in particular was chosen and may not even be true: for instance, if you had courage, your character might have been known for saving someone’s life and be hiding the fact that they are in fact not particularly brave. You can play around with this however you want, so long as it’s conceivable that somebody would think your character displays that trait. PM me if you have an idea for this and aren’t sure if you can use it.


Note: The types are meant to reflect reasons that the characters would be considered unlikely heroes, and is no reflections on any people of those types - in fact, the point is the exact opposite.


Types


Elderly

This character is somewhere over seventy years of age. They may be in great shape and not care how old they are, but the fact remains that they’re still elderly. They’re the most likely to have seen the heroes in person - perhaps they’ve even met one or more.


Physically Disabled

This character is physically disabled in some way, leading many people to underestimate them. They may be perfectly able to get along in the world, but they are generally considered not the type of person who could become a hero.


Bad Reputation

People in your character’s town or area have a real, genuine reason to dislike your character. It may be an incident or just a general attitude, and maybe they regret it or maybe they don’t. Whatever the reason, your character is generally unwelcome in many places.


Incompetent

However sweet your character may be, they are completely incompetent. They might have bungled stuff up long ago and not tried since, or may continuously get everything wrong. They simply can’t seem to do anything right, or if they do have a skill, it’s pretty much useless.


Outsider

This person may be from outside of Victory, or belong to a very specific subgroup. Whatever the reason is, their viewpoint on common human experiences is so different that people find it hard to relate to them. Maybe they’re tried to change, but they continue to be shunned no matter what.


Attachment

This person has a very strong attachment to another person that they feel the need to protect, beyond anything else they feel the need to do. This could be a pregnant woman or new mother, or maybe someone who looks after a family member or friend who can’t look after themselves.

Rules

  1. There may be only one trait and archetype per character, and no two people may have the same

  2. Don’t add traits/archetypes without asking me first

  3. If we run out of room, you’re free to suggest an archetype, hero, and corresponding trait so that you may join

  4. Be kind to one another - you know, just be nice people

  5. Reservations last one day, and posting a WIP will extend that two more days

  6. This is all medieval, though you may add flavor that’s not necessarily consistent with medieval culture if you want to - just ask me first

  7. Though not a rule, I strongly suggest you pick an archetype and trait you’re not familiar with so you can expand your roleplaying abilities

  8. Have fun. That’s right, this is a rule. All those who do not have fun will be unceremoniously booted out of the RP ;)
